Francis MarianiI don't think you'll find documentation specific to .sty. Styling (in code) is documented all over the "Identifying a Report Component in a WebFOCUS StyleSheet", "Laying Out the Report Page", "Using Headings, Footings, Titles, and Labels", "Specifying Font Format in a Report" and probably other chapters of "Creating Reports With WebFOCUS Language" - there is no ONE document to view.
